Long Term Substitute – School Social Worker
Eastview Education Center
Full time (1.0 FTE) position – Temporary
Available 09/18/2024 through 12/17/2024
Job Summary:
The School Social Worker provides direct and indirect social work services to students experiencing social, emotional and/or behavioral problems that interfere with their performance in school, and facilitates communication among school, home and community providers.
Licensure:
- Current licensure through the Minnesota Board of Social Work required
- Current School Social Worker license with the Minnesota Department of Education required
Experience:
- Three years of experience in social work
- Experience working with early elementary age (kindergarten) school students
- Experience/training with CLR (Culturally Linguistically Responsive) methods preferred
- Experience with academic planning and career exploration
Essential Skills Required:
- Experience with alternative pathways
- Awareness of best practices for secondary counseling/procedures
- Effective communication and teaming skills, both verbally and in writing, with students, parents, teachers, administrators, community and staff
-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ously
- Ability to demonstrate professionalism and ethical practices
- Maintain confidentiality of information about students and families
- Experience working with diverse students and families
- Assist with supervision of students during non-academic education activities
